The Impact You'll Make in this Role As a Senior Analytical Chemist, you will have the opportunity to tap into your curiosity and collaborate with some of the most innovative people around the world. Here, you will make an impact by: Preparing environmental samples using various sample preparation/extraction techniques Analyzing environmental samples using Liquid Chromatography/Mass Spectrometry (LC-MS/MS) and Combustion Ion Chromatography (CIC) methods Using statistical data analysis methods to evaluate analytical test data Implementing and evaluating procedures to improve sample preparation and analysis efficiency and productivity Preparing detailed laboratory reports, data sheets, and other documentation in accordance to the Global Environmental Health and Safety (EHS) Laboratory's Quality System and Good Laboratory Practice (GLP) processes Your Skills and Expertise To set you up for success in this role from day one, 3M requires (at a minimum) the following qualifications: Bachelor's degree or higher in Chemistry, Biochemistry, Analytical Chemistry, Chemical Engineering, Biology, or Environmental Science (completed and verified prior to start) One (1) or more years of experience in advanced chromatography techniques including one or more of the following: Liquid Chromatography/Mass Spectrometry (LC-MS/MS), Liquid Chromatography-Ion Chromatography (LC-IC), and/or Combustion Ion Chromatography (CIC) in a academic, public, government or military environment. Additional qualifications that could help you succeed even further in this role include: Possess a Master's or Ph.D. degree (completed and verified prior to start) in a science discipline from an accredited institution Four (4) years of experience performing Liquid Chromatography/Mass Spectrometry (LC-MS/MS) analysis in a private, public, government or military environment Experience performing LC-MS/MS analysis in a U.S. EPA GLP compliant and/or ISO/IEC 17025 accredited environmental testing laboratory. Strong analytical chemistry knowledge and proficiency with Agilent HPLC and/or AB Sciex MS/MS instrumentation/software. Experience with Metrohm Ion Chromatography and Combustion Ion Chromatography equipment Experience in test method development and validations Prior laboratory experience with ISO 17025 accreditation Prior experience working with a Laboratory Information Management System (LIMS) Demonstrated project management skills with the ability to coordinate multiple tasks/projects and manage priorities accordingly Strong written and verbal communication skills, excellent documentation skills, ability to work independently to complete projects, as well as work with cross-functional teams. Microsoft Office proficient Work Location: Onsite in Cottage Grove, MN Travel: May include up to 10% domestic/international Relocation Assistance: Is authorized Must be legally authorized to work in country of employment without sponsorship for employment visa status (e.g., H1B status).
